Class F - GA Exam With Complete Solutions
Latest Update


What is the major reason for performing a vehicle inspection? ANSWER Safety. Safety to
yourself and other road user.



What should you check while on a drive? ANSWER Watch your gauges, mirrors, and use
your senses to check for problems.LOOK, LISTEN, AND SMELL.



Name some key steering system parts. - ANSWER steering wheel, tie rod, steering shaft,
hydraulic fluid reservoir, gear box, pitman arm, drag link, steering knuckle, spindle,
steering arm, power steering cylinder



Name some suspension system defects - ANSWER spring hangers that allow movement
of axle from proper position, cracked or broken spring hangers, missing or broken
leaves in any leaf spring, leaking shock absorbers, air suspension systems that are
damaged and or leaking, any parts of the suspension or frame that is cracked or broken



What three types of emergency equipment do you need to carry? - ANSWER fire
extinguisher, 3 reflective triangles, spare fuses



What is the minimum tread depth for steering tires? For all other tires? - ANSWER You
need at least 4/32-inch tread depth in every major groove on front tires. You need 2/32
inch on other tires. No fabric should show through the tread or sidewall.



Name things you should check on the front of your vehicle during the walk around
inspection? - ANSWER Condition of front axle, Condition of steering system, Condition of
windshield, Lights and reflectors.



What should wheel bearing seals be checked for? - ANSWER leaks

, How many red reflective triangles should you carry? - ANSWER three



How do you test hydraulic brakes for leaks? - ANSWER Pump the brake pedal three
times, then apply firm pressure to the pedal and hold for five seconds. The pedal should
not move.



Why put the starter switch key in your pocket during the pre-trip inspection? - ANSWER
to prevent anyone from moving the truck



Why back towards the driver's side? - ANSWER So you can see better. You can watch
the rear of your vehicle by looking out the side window.



If stopped on a hill, how can you start moving without rolling back? - ANSWER Partly
engage the clutch before you take your right foot off the brake.



Why should you use a helper while backing? - ANSWER There are blind spots you can't
see!



What's the most important hand signal that you can the helper should agree on? -
ANSWER Stop



What are the two special conditions where you should downshift? - ANSWER before
starting down a hill, before entering a curve



When should you downshift automatic transmissions? - ANSWER when going down
grades



Retarders keep you from skidding when the road is slippery. True or False? -ANSWER
FALSE. When your drive wheels have poor traction, the retarder may actually CAUSE
them to skid and should be turned off whenever the road is wet, icy or snow covered
